While you might think to check your messages and social media are relaxing for you, this habit could be robbing you of the quality sleep you need.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The light your devices emit can suppress your body\u2019s production of melatonin. This hormone regulates sleep. With insufficient levels of melatonin, you could struggle to sleep properly.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Looking at the pictures and videos online or constructing messages stimulates the brain. If you find something interesting, you\u2019re inclined to ignore your body\u2019s circadian rhythm, which dictates the body\u2019s sleep patterns. People who use their devices at bedtime are more likely to stay up later.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Experts advise that you put your devices aside at least 30 minutes before you go to sleep. Put them on silent so that the sound of alerts doesn\u2019t waken you.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<ol start=\"2\">\n<li><b> Try natural alternatives<\/b><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Instead of pharmaceutical sleep remedies, there are natural options to consider. People with sleep problems have reported an improvement when they exercise. Exercise is a panacea for stress, which is often the cause of sleeplessness.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">One of the body\u2019s neurotransmitters that govern its sense of well-being is serotonin. A <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/pubmed\/17984558\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">serotonin imbalance<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> can cause depression and insomnia. Exercise stimulates the release of serotonin, which is also known as the feel-good hormone.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It\u2019s not wise to exercise right before bed since it stimulates the body and brain. Depending on your preference, you can exercise either in the morning or late in the afternoon.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<ol start=\"4\">\n<li><b> Your sleep environment<\/b><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">You cannot sleep if you are uncomfortable. Make sure your <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.webmd.com\/sleep-disorders\/news\/20110126\/want-sleep-better-make-your-bed#1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">mattress and pillows<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> are comfortable. What you wear to bed can also affect your ability to rest properly. You should not wear restrictive garments to bed.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Your bedroom should be dark when it\u2019s time to sleep. Any light that enters the room can cause you to come out of deep sleep. You might still be asleep, but the quality of your sleep is hampered by light.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Try to create a sleep routine. While there will be exceptions, you should be going to bed and waking up at the same time each day. Read or listen to music to calm your mind and body, allowing you to fall asleep quickly.<\/span><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Do you struggle to fall asleep or sleep through the night? He is the creator of Active Dreaming, an original synthesis of dreamwork and shamanism. Born in Australia, he survived three near-death experiences in childhood. He leads popular seminars all over the world, including a three-year training for teachers of Active Dreaming. A former lecturer in ancient history at the Australian National University, he is a best-selling novelist, journalist and independent scholar. His nine books on dreaming, shamanism and imagination include Conscious Dreaming, Dreamways of the Iroquois, The Dreamer's Book of the Dead, The Three \"\"Only\"\" Things, The Secret History of Dreaming, Dreamgates, Active Dreaming and Dreaming the Soul Back Home: Shamanic Dreaming for Healing and Becoming Whole. His most recent book is The Boy Who Died and Came Back: Adventures of a Dream Archaeologist in the Multiverse. Over the past 20 years, he has led seminars at the Esalen Institute, Kripalu, the Omega Institute, the New York Open Center, Bastyr University, John F. Kennedy University, Meriter Hospital, and many other centers and institutions. He has taught depth workshops in Active Dreaming in the UK, Australia, Canada, Costa Rica, France, the Netherlands, Denmark, Sweden, Lithuania, Latvia, Estonia, Romania, Brazil and Austria and leads a three-year training for teachers of Active Dreaming. He hosts the \"\"Way of the Dreamer\"\" radio show at www.healthylife.net. He has appeared on many TV and radio shows, ranging from Charlie Rose and the Today show to Coast to Coast and the Diane Rehm show on NPR. His articles on dreaming have been published in media ranging from Parade to Shaman's Drum.","sameAs":["http:\/\/www.mossdreams.com"],"url":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/author\/rmoss"}]}},"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/6371","targetHints":{"allow":["GET"]}}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/post"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/224"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/comments?post=6371"}],"version-history":[{"count":1,"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/6371\/revisions"}],"predecessor-version":[{"id":6372,"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/6371\/revisions\/6372"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=6371"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/categories?post=6371"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.beliefnet.com\/columnists\/dreamgates\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/tags?post=6371"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
